ULTIMORA/ Cade e batte la testa sugli scogli, bagnante salvato da guardia costiera e 118
(CFN) NISIDA – Bagnante salvato dalla sinergia dei soccorsi questa mattina a Nisida. Secondo formidabile intervento svolto alla Gaiola dalle postazioni 118 Corso Europa e Crispi. Alle ore 10 un bagnante cade sugli scogli, batte la testa e riporta trauma cranico commotivo, immediatamente vengono allertare le 2 postazioni 118 che in pochi minuti arrivano sul posto. Viene attivata la guardia costiera che preleva il ferito e lo trasporta via mare presso la Marina militare di Nisida dove uno dei 2 mezzi di soccorso lo trasporta al cardarelli in totale sicurezza.
